VIVO ENERGY KENYA LIMITED V. MALOBA PETROL STATION LIMITED, TOTAL KENYA LIMITED, PETROLEUM LIMITED & TIMOTHY ASOMBA MALOBA

(2014) JELR 93427 (CA)

Court of Appeal  •  Civil Appeal 21 of 2014  •  18 Dec 2014  •  Kenya

Coram
Erastus Mwaniki Githinji, William Ouko, Kathurima M'inoti

Judgement

JUDGEMENT OF THE COURT

This is an interlocutory appeal from the ruling and order of the High Court of Kenya at Kakamega (Chitembwe, J.) dated 11th April 2014. For clarity and ease of reference we shall refer to the parties in the appeal as follows: the appellant, Vivo Energy Kenya Limited, shall be referred to as Vivo; the 1st respondent, Maloba Petrol Station Limited, as Maloba Station; the 2nd Respondent, Total Kenya Ltd, as Total; the 3rd respondent, Bukhungu Petroleum Ltd, as Bukhungu; and the 4th respondent Timothy Asomba Maloba, as Mr. Maloba.

By the said ruling the learned judge granted an injunction restraining Vivo, Maloba Station and Mr. Maloba from interfering with Total’s possession and operations on LR No. Kakamega Municipality/Block 1/548 (the suit property) until the hearing and determination of Kakamega High Court Land and Environment Case No. 345 of 2013.
